Liam O'Toole said,
"Look at the configuration files under ~/.config/xfce4. You should be
able to find the file which holds the panel configuration, and delete it."
Liam, that worked easily enough. I deleted only
the file /home/peter/.config/xfce4/panel/panels.xml
and configured to taste. Thanks for the tip about
not having xfce4 running.
